Axelar claims to deliver “secure cross-chain communication for Web3.” The project provides a decentralized network and tools to help builders of decentralized applications (dApps) with seamless cross-chain communication through its protocol suite, tools and APIs.
Read more on AXL →Tria is a self-custodial crypto neobank and cross-chain routing engine that enables seamless spending, trading, and earning within one application. It addresses blockchain fragmentation through its BestPath routing technology, enabling gasless, bridge-free transactions and card payments directly from user-controlled wallets. The TRIA token supports rewards, ecosystem access, and governance participation.
